## Releases

Vramscope releases are cut from the `stable` branch every six weeks by the Telder Labs tooling team. Plugin authors should pin against a specific minor version, as the profiler's memory-event schema may change between minors. Every release tarball ships with a detached signature, and plugins loaded into the profiler daemon must verify it before linking against the capture ABI. Checksums alone are not sufficient; signature verification is mandatory for distribution. The public signing key used for all release artifacts is below.

rollout seal: bky3_Zik

## Break-Glass Access — EchoHalls Audio Guide

If the Galleria sync service is down and normal admin login fails, use the break-glass flow. Confirm the outage in the Murelli status channel first, then open the sealed recovery console from the Tourcast bastion host. Log every action in the incident record. The passphrase to unlock the console is below.

strongbox words: prawyn-fenmir

## Deploying the Gatewick Proctor Queue

Deploys are pretty painless: push to main, wait for the pipeline, then watch the queue drain dashboard for five minutes. If candidates pile up mid-exam, roll back first and ask questions later — the queue replays safely. Everything the workers care about lives in one config block, shown here for reference.

settings of bafof-yagef:
JOROX_PIN=8740
JOROX_TENANT=pelox
JOROX_METRICS_HOST=metrics.jorox.qorvelworks.internal
JOROX_SEAL=seal_c78f63c1
JOROX_STANDBY_TEAM=norax